Male’, MALDIVES – Victory’s top striker, Mohammed Umair never thought that he would be able to top the goal scoring chart. Umair is leveled with Ali Ashfaq at the top of the goal scorers with 23 goals each. Umair will have three matches if Victory moves into the finals of the FA Cup while Ashfaq has one match remaining.
“I never thought that I would top the goal scoring chart. It is not just my effort; it is a team effort that I am able to score goals”
Umair also believes that his team players were a bit careless in the matches between the two clubs this season. New Radiant has won three matches and managed a draw in the matches between the two teams so far in the season.
“I think we have a better squad compared to New Radiant. We could have won the games, but we were a bit careless and the mistakes cost us the game. We will correct those mistakes and fight for a win in tomorrow night’s match”
“I believe if we can concentrate well and play our game, we would be able to win the match”
Umair also urged the supporters of Victory to be present in the stadium to cheer the club.
“I ask the supporters to come and watch the game.”
The president’s cup final between New Radiant and Victory will be played tomorrow afternoon at 1550hrs.
